Portrait (tall) Use portrait when the panel needs to be taller than wide – e.g. floor-to-ceiling.
Landscape (wide) Use landscape when the panel needs to be wider than tall – e.g. half-height walls, media walls, shelving.
Dimensions All measurements are shown in millimetres (mm). For half-height walls, we usually recommend around 1200mm high. For exact finished sizes, choose Cut To Size so we cut to your exact mm.
Design direction The panel pattern always runs vertically in both portrait and landscape. To achieve horizontal lines, order portrait and install on its side.
Measuring Tips
Walls are rarely perfectly straight - allow a few extra mm if needed
Measure from the top of the skirting (not the floor)
If there is coving, measure from the bottom of the coving
Panels join seamlessly in almost all cases
If joining two full-size sheets (2440×1220mm or 3050×1220mm) these may need a light trim for a perfect seamless join
